First, and most important, don't leave alkaline cells in your radio for long periods. They will eventually leak. If you have the KXBC3 installed, I suggest high quality Low Self Discharge (LSD) NiMh cells such as Eneloops, If you don't have the KXBC3 installed, non-rechargeable Lithium cells would be a good choice, although those are pretty pricey where I live. I could quickly justify the cost of a KXBC3 based on the price of non-rechargeable Lithium cells. The Eneloop LSD Rechargeable cells have a great track record. I've had my Eneloop 2000 cells since February 2013 with no problems. I think I am finally just starting to detect signs of reduced capacity, so maybe it is time to upgrade them to the newer, higher capacity Eneloops. I have tried non-LSD NiMH cells from time to time, but they really don't work very well. They quickly self-discharge to below 1 volt per cell, damaging themselves in the process. Don't waste you money on them. Cells that are shipped fully charged are usually LSD.
